Output 8523593f14fa5635c7ba9154ad848c1f359d8e6925c641f78ab7e98489a20b07:0

value
686000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 807708225b62c4161dc7e276efea096f1bf3c9a4dd13a9f9caee43c3e1fff2dc
address
bc1pspmssgjmvtzpv8w8ufmwl6sfdudl8jdym5f6n7w2aepu8c0l7twqj498c2
transaction
8523593f14fa5635c7ba9154ad848c1f359d8e6925c641f78ab7e98489a20b07